The unique THINKY Mixer is a no-touch, no-blade wayof mixing materials employing rotation and revolution.In much the same way as the Earth revolves aroundthe Sun, the mixing container orbits the center andalso turns upon its axis; these two contradictory forcessimultaneously and thoroughly mix, disperse anddeaerate materials in the container.
Uniform mixing of materials with different viscositiesor specific gravitiesDispersion of high-density material with no sedimen-tationDispersion of nanoparticles with no aggregationNano-level pulverizing and dispersing of insolublecompoundsMixing high volumes of particles into resin
As new materials are developed, new demands alsoincrease; our planetary centrifugal THINKY Mixer Serieswith deaeration technology enables highly advancedand efficient material processing.Our models with a vacuum pressure reduction functioneliminate micron-sized bubbles. The time and costsrequired for cleaning machines and material waste arealso kept to the minimum. These models have beenenthusiastically taken up by a broad range of industriesand are found in research and development labs andproduction facilities for semiconductors, liquid crystals,paints, pharmaceuticals, cosmetics, food products, andsuch electronic materials as resin and metallic paste.

Rotation and Revolution: A universe within which two centrifugal forcespowerfully and harmoniously orbit, turn and spinTHINKY Mixer with deaeration technology means no bubbles.
◀THINKY Mixer ARV SeriesThe ARV Series has a vacuum pressurereduction function in addition to the rotationand revolution system, and generatespowerful centrifugal forces, removing anyconcerns of material spillage; with justone switch, anybody can now carry outquick and easy simultaneous mixing anddeaeration and ensure the highest quality.
◀Conventional vacuum deaeratorsConvent iona l vacuum deaerat ion systemsare costly in terms of time and labor, requiringconstant monitoring to control spillage, and thereare limitations on precision and accuracy.

Mechanism of the THINKY MixerPlace the container and materials into
the holder angled at 45 degrees to therevolution axis.
Start operationRevolution: Wide clockwise revolutions.Powerful acceleration of deaeration.Rotation: Rotates counterclockwisecentered on the container axis andalong the revolution orbit. Power thataccelerates mixing.The interaction between rotation andrevolution generates a spiral flow andrising and falling convection currents. Airbubbles within the material are efficientlypressed out to the surface, thus enablingmixing and dispersion without bubblesfolding back into the mix.

Features●Uniform mixing and in a short time: many
different materials can be mixed, from liquidsand high-density materials to nano-levelpowders.
●Uniform mixing of materials with verydif ferent compound ratios and specif icgravities.
●Powerful acceleration exceeding 400 Gs*allows simultaneous mixing and deaeration.Products with a vacuum pressure reductionfunction eliminate micron-sized bubbles. Theproduct range also includes models withan atmospheric pressure deaeration mode,which is compatible with materials that arenot suitable for vacuum deaeration, such assolvent components or water.
*Acceleration differs according to the product.
●Mixes and disperses mater ia ls whi lemaintaining their constituent shape (fibersand powders) and functions without causingbreakdowns.
●Mixing and deaeration of very small volumes.●Timer setting and memory function for
registering procedures allows the creation ofrecipe manuals for each material.
●No blades means no tool cleaning.●Simple structure ensures simple main-

By coupling a vacuum pressure reductionfunction with the rotation and revolutionsystem simultaneous mixing and deaerationis poss ib le a long wi th the completeel imination of submicron air bubbles.Because of the revolution centrifugal forcethere is no spil lage of material duringoperation; just posit ion the containerand switch on. Even urethane materialsand h igh-v iscos i t y mater ia ls can besimultaneously mixed and deaerated in justten seconds to several minutes. Automaticand easily-set sequences allow optimalconditions to be reproduced with highaccuracy, enabling superior quality control.

Incorporating a two-container system theARV-930 TWIN can process up to 1 liter ofmaterials and is suitable for manufacturing.Simultaneous uniform mixing and dispersioncan be carried out with submicron-leveldeaeration. For deaeration, in addition to 400Gs of vacuum processing, an atmosphericpressure deaeration mode that generatespowerful acceleration to a maximum of670 Gs is incorporated as standard; volatilematerials, which are not suitable for vacuumdeaeration, can be efficiently deaeratedto a high standard. Moreover, THINKY'soriginal cup holder vacuum system holdsthe decompression volume to a minimum,thus significantly reducing vacuum decom-pression time.

Temperature and viscosity adjustment+deaeration:Processing in only a few minutes
Of f-the-shel f 500 -gram solder pastecontainers can be set directly into themachine just as they are. By revolving thecontainer at a high speed and rotatingat the same time, the SR-500 generatespower ful acceleration and convectioncurrents, and carr ies out mix ing anddeaeration simultaneously. Solder powderthat settled during storage is uniformlydispersed and returns to a near factorydelivered high-quality state. In addition, theSR-500 eliminates the fine air bubbles thatare believed to cause solder ball scattering.When solder is taken straight from therefrigerator and put into the machine, theideal temperature and viscosity can bereached in a short time.
